			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>This post might be slightly controversial</strong>, just due to the fact that when starting a low carb diet, you&#8217;re supposed to cut out soda all together (even diet). It&#8217;s obvious why you would cut out regular soda, because it&#8217;s mostly made of sugar, but diet? Why cut out diet soda?!?</p>
<p>My first time on a low carb diet several years ago, I was fully committed but I absolutely would not cut out Diet Pepsi. I just wasn&#8217;t going to do it. You see, a lot of so called &#8220;experts&#8221; say that the aspartame and caffeine can actually cause you to not lose weight and may stall you, but, in my many pounds lost on Atkins, I continually drink 5-6 diet sodas per day without any adverse diet side effects. No problem.</p>
<p>Maybe I&#8217;m lucky, as I&#8217;ve heard that artificial sweeteners and caffeine actually do affect some low carb dieters&#8230;but I think it mainly affects those that only have a little weight to lose. I could be totally wrong on that, but for those of us that need to lose 50+ pounds, the radical change in the food we eat will be enough to kick start the weight loss process.</p>
